real estate investment trust
A business that invests in real estate. Investors buy shares in a REIT to invest in real estate in much the same way as they might buy shares in a mutual fund to invest in stocks. A REIT is set up to minimize or avoid corporate income taxes.

+ Real Estate Investment Trust (REIT)
USA
A tax designation for a corporation, trust or association that owns and operates real estate. REIT status lowers or eliminates corporate income tax liability. REITs can be held privately or publicly, and can be listed on stock exchanges. They must distribute 90% of their income to investors every year as dividends. Financial institutions and insurance companies do not qualify. Each state has a distinct treatment of REITs, and not every state has a specific REIT statute.

real estate investment trust
n.
   nicknamed REIT, a real estate investment organization which finds investors and buys real property and gives each investor either a percentage interest in the property itself or an interest in a loan secured by a mortgage or deed of trust on the property. Usually the loan is used to develop the property and build upon it, and then there is a division of profits upon sale-if there is a profit.
